Trusted by engineers across multiple sectors, this 0.794" thick Aluminum 6061 stock sheet (35" x 48") exemplifies superior mechanical properties. Belonging to the 6xxx series, it features aluminum, magnesium, and silicon, providing excellent strength-to-weight ratio, good formability, and superior corrosion resistance, particularly in welded constructions. This alloy is readily machinable and exhibits good weldability. Its high tensile strength and yield strength make it a reliable choice for structural components, marine applications, automotive parts, and safety barriers requiring robust yet lightweight solutions.
